Internal link tip:
From every Day X page, link:

  • Back to Healing Journeys

  • To Self-Talk Practices (matching the theme, e.g. anxiety)

  • To 1–2 relevant Audio tracks

This creates a triangle: Journey ↔ Practices ↔ Audio.

C. Recommended Internal Link Pattern

Here’s a simple pattern so visitors never hit a dead end:

1. Home /

Already good:

  • Links to Start Here, Why Words Heal, Self-Talk Practices, Healing Journeys, Audio, Articles, About.

  • Also includes a 7-day email opt-in.

2. Start Here

At the bottom (you already have this):

  • Link to Why Words Heal (understanding)

  • Link to Self-Talk Practices (doing)

  • Link to Healing Journeys (deeper path)

  • Link to Audio & Meditations (supportive voice)

This page becomes your “first aid + orientation” hub.

3. Why Words Heal

  • Within body copy, link to:

    • Articles (for deeper theory / examples)

    • Self-Talk Practices (to apply the concepts)

    • Healing Journeys (to commit to a path)

  • At the end: a small “Next Steps” box pointing clearly to those 3.

D. Simple SEO Keyword Focus (Soft, Not Spammy)

Just to hold in the back of your mind while you write/edit:

  • Main themes / phrases:

    • healing self-talk

    • gentle self-talk

    • self-talk for anxiety

    • self-talk for grief

    • self-talk for shame

    • self-talk for pain

    • healing words / words that heal

    • anxiety and the nervous system

    • freeze response and trauma

You’re already naturally writing these; we’ll just let them appear in:

  • H1 / H2 headings

  • First paragraphs

  • Link anchor text (e.g., self-talk for anxiety rather than just “click here”).
